Borderlands Farm is a small Northern Ontario sheep farm and wool mill offering lamb, wool, garlic, and seasonal flowers — well-made goods, from a farm that stays close to the work and close to the people who use it.

Our Story
This farm is a relatively new family partnership between Beverly and Bryan Barlow, and their daughter Gwen along with her husband Brody Marsonet. We started our farm in 2020, adding the wool mill in 2023.

What We Do
We are a sheep farm and wool mill operation. We raise Polypay sheep and purebred heritage Lincoln Longwool sheep for both their meat and their fibre. We also have a market garden focusing on garlic and flowers.
​
Beverly also makes unique wool products under the name Border House Fibre Arts.

Where We Are
We are a small farm about 30 minutes outside of Thunder Bay, Ontario in Neebing.
​
Our products are available seasonally through our website, at the Thunder Bay Country Market, and through Superior Seasons.
